Platform
More than one responsibility per staff member
A staff member can now hold several responsibilities at the same time, each one tied to a branch and, if you want, an end date after which it lapses. You give and take them away from the staff member's own page. Class teacher, house in-charge and head of department duties now follow by themselves from what your school already records, so nobody has to be added twice.
A new Access page in Settings
Settings now has an Access page that lists every standard responsibility, spells out in plain words what someone holding it can do, shows who holds it today, and keeps a dated record of every change so you can see who was given what and when.
A tidier quick search
The quick search you open with Command-K is now a smaller, neater panel that fits about twice as many results on screen, and the page behind it dims so it is easier to read. Searching for a student, a parent or a staff member by name works exactly as before.

Library
One look across every Library form
Adding a book, editing or withdrawing a copy, correcting a register line and the Library settings screens now all open in the same tidy layout used elsewhere in ScholaRise, with a clear heading, titled sections and the buttons always in the same place. Nothing about how these steps work has changed.
